Topik ini menjelaskan spesifikasi dari instans Tair (Edisi Perusahaan) yang dioptimalkan untuk memori dan menggunakan arsitektur pemisahan baca/tulis. Spesifikasi tersebut mencakup jumlah replika baca, kapasitas memori, jumlah koneksi maksimum, bandwidth, serta nilai referensi untuk permintaan per detik (QPS).
Spesifikasi instans
Spesifikasi | InstanceClass (untuk panggilan API) | Inti CPU | Thread I/O | Node read-only | Bandwidth (MB/s) | Jumlah koneksi maksimum ( modus proxy ) | Referensi QPS |
1 GB edisi pemisahan baca/tulis (2 replika, termasuk 1 replika baca saja) | redis.amber.logic.splitrw.small.1db.1rodb.6proxy.multithread | 12 | 4 | 1 | 192 | 60.000 | 480.000 |
2 GB edisi pemisahan baca/tulis (2 replika, termasuk 1 replika baca saja) | redis.amber.logic.splitrw.mid.1db.1rodb.6proxy.multithread | 12 | 4 | 1 | 192 | 60.000 | 480.000 |
4 GB edisi pemisahan baca/tulis (2 replika, termasuk 1 replika baca saja) | redis.amber.logic.splitrw.stand.1db.1rodb.6proxy.multithread | 12 | 4 | 1 | 192 | 60.000 | 480.000 |
8 GB edisi pemisahan baca/tulis (2 replika, termasuk 1 replika baca saja) | redis.amber.logic.splitrw.large.1db.1rodb.6proxy.multithread | 12 | 4 | 1 | 192 | 60.000 | 480.000 |
16 GB edisi pemisahan baca/tulis (2 replika, termasuk 1 replika baca saja) | redis.amber.logic.splitrw.2xlarge.1db.1rodb.6proxy.multithread | 12 | 4 | 1 | 192 | 60.000 | 480.000 |
32 GB edisi pemisahan baca/tulis (2 replika, termasuk 1 replika baca saja) | redis.amber.logic.splitrw.4xlarge.1db.1rodb.6proxy.multithread | 12 | 4 | 1 | 192 | 60.000 | 480.000 |
64 GB edisi pemisahan baca/tulis (2 replika, termasuk 1 replika baca saja) | redis.amber.logic.splitrw.8xlarge.1db.1rodb.6proxy.multithread | 12 | 4 | 1 | 192 | 60.000 | 480.000 |
1 GB edisi pemisahan baca/tulis (4 replika, termasuk 3 replika baca saja) | redis.amber.logic.splitrw.small.1db.3rodb.12proxy.multithread | 24 | 4 | 3 | 384 | 120.000 | 960.000 |
2 GB edisi pemisahan baca/tulis (4 replika, termasuk 3 replika baca saja) | redis.amber.logic.splitrw.mid.1db.3rodb.12proxy.multithread | 24 | 4 | 3 | 384 | 120.000 | 960.000 |
4 GB edisi pemisahan baca/tulis (4 replika, termasuk 3 replika baca saja) | redis.amber.logic.splitrw.stand.1db.3rodb.12proxy.multithread | 24 | 4 | 3 | 384 | 120.000 | 960.000 |
8 GB edisi pemisahan baca/tulis (4 replika, termasuk 3 replika baca saja) | redis.amber.logic.splitrw.large.1db.3rodb.12proxy.multithread | 24 | 4 | 3 | 384 | 120.000 | 960.000 |
16 GB edisi pemisahan baca/tulis (4 replika, termasuk 3 replika baca saja) | redis.amber.logic.splitrw.2xlarge.1db.3rodb.12proxy.multithread | 24 | 4 | 3 | 384 | 120.000 | 960.000 |
32 GB edisi pemisahan baca/tulis (4 replika, termasuk 3 replika baca saja) | redis.amber.logic.splitrw.4xlarge.1db.3rodb.12proxy.multithread | 24 | 4 | 3 | 384 | 120.000 | 960.000 |
64 GB edisi pemisahan baca/tulis (4 replika, termasuk 3 replika baca saja) | redis.amber.logic.splitrw.8xlarge.1db.3rodb.12proxy.multithread | 24 | 4 | 3 | 384 | 120.000 | 960.000 |
1 GB edisi pemisahan baca/tulis (6 replika, termasuk 5 replika baca saja) | redis.amber.logic.splitrw.small.1db.5rodb.18proxy.multithread | 36 | 4 | 5 | 576 | 480.000 | 1.440.000 |
2 GB edisi pemisahan baca/tulis (6 replika, termasuk 5 replika baca saja) | redis.amber.logic.splitrw.mid.1db.5rodb.18proxy.multithread | 36 | 4 | 5 | 576 | 480.000 | 1.440.000 |
4 GB edisi pemisahan baca/tulis (6 replika, termasuk 5 replika baca saja) | redis.amber.logic.splitrw.stand.1db.5rodb.18proxy.multithread | 36 | 4 | 5 | 576 | 480.000 | 1.440.000 |
8 GB edisi pemisahan baca/tulis (6 replika, termasuk 5 replika baca saja) | redis.amber.logic.splitrw.large.1db.5rodb.18proxy.multithread | 36 | 4 | 5 | 576 | 480.000 | 1.440.000 |
16 GB edisi pemisahan baca/tulis (6 replika, termasuk 5 replika baca saja) | redis.amber.logic.splitrw.2xlarge.1db.5rodb.18proxy.multithread | 36 | 4 | 5 | 576 | 480.000 | 1.440.000 |
32 GB edisi pemisahan baca/tulis (6 replika, termasuk 5 replika baca saja) | redis.amber.logic.splitrw.4xlarge.1db.5rodb.18proxy.multithread | 36 | 4 | 5 | 576 | 480.000 | 1.440.000 |
64 GB edisi pemisahan baca/tulis (6 replika, termasuk 5 replika baca saja) | redis.amber.logic.splitrw.8xlarge.1db.5rodb.18proxy.multithread | 36 | 4 | 5 | 576 | 480.000 | 1.440.000 |
Inti CPU
Untuk memastikan stabilitas layanan, sistem menyediakan satu inti CPU untuk memproses tugas latar belakang . Untuk kluster atau arsitektur pemisahan baca/tulis, sistem menyediakan satu inti CPU untuk setiap shard data atau node read-only guna memproses tugas latar belakang.
Aturan perhitungan bandwidth
Nilai bandwidth dalam tabel mewakili total bandwidth untuk seluruh instans, yaitu jumlah dari bandwidth semua shard atau node dalam instans tersebut.
Total bandwidth maksimum untuk instans pemisahan baca/tulis adalah 2.048 MB/s. Bandwidth tidak bertambah melebihi batas ini, meskipun Anda memilih tipe instans dengan lebih banyak node.
Nilai bandwidth berlaku untuk bandwidth hulu dan hilir. Sebagai contoh, jika suatu tipe instans memiliki bandwidth 96 MB/s, maka baik bandwidth hulu maupun hilirnya adalah 96 MB/s.
CatatanJika instans Anda mengalami lonjakan trafik yang tidak terduga atau direncanakan, Anda dapat menyesuaikan bandwidth instans. Untuk informasi lebih lanjut, lihat Secara Manual Meningkatkan Bandwidth Sebuah Instans.
Batas bandwidth untuk Tair dan Redis merujuk pada bandwidth shard, terlepas dari jenis koneksi jaringan.
Untuk informasi lebih lanjut tentang bandwidth, lihat FAQ Bandwidth.
Rincian jumlah koneksi maksimum
Modus proxy: Jumlah koneksi maksimum untuk sebuah instans adalah 480.000. Jumlah koneksi maksimum tidak bertambah melebihi batas ini, meskipun Anda menambahkan lebih banyak shard atau node.
Untuk instans yang dibuat sebelum 1 Maret 2020, jumlah koneksi maksimum dalam modus proxy adalah 200.000.
Saat menggunakan perintah PUBSUB, BLOCK, atau transaksi dalam modus proxy, proxy membuat koneksi backend khusus untuk koneksi klien. Koneksi ini tidak dapat digabungkan. Oleh karena itu, jumlah koneksi maksimum dibatasi oleh batas koneksi dari satu shard data, yaitu 30.000.